Top 10 Premier League strikers of all time - #4

Sports Mole's countdown of the top 10 Premier League strikers of all time continues with number four - Sergio Aguero.

Sergio Aguero (Manchester City)

Sergio Aguero celebrates scoring for Manchester City in the Community Shield on August 5, 2018© Reuters

The only player still in the Premier League to feature on this list, Manchester City's Sergio Aguero recently passed the 150-goal mark in the competition and shows no signs of slowing down just yet.

Already Man City's all-time leading scorer, Aguero will forever be etched into the history books of both the club and the Premier League for his unforgettable last-gasp title-winning goal against Queens Park Rangers in 2012.

There have been plenty of other highlights during his time at the club too, though, including two more title wins and three League Cup triumphs - a trophy haul City look likely to increase given their current dominance of English football.

Aguero has broken the 20-goal barrier in the Premier League in five of his seven seasons at the Etihad including each of the last four - a streak he is well on course to extending at the time of writing.

Only Harry Kane can match Aguero's strike rate from the 28 players to have scored 100 Premier League goals or more, with Aguero having netted 151 times in just 218 games as of November 22, 2018.
